HeraldNG reports that the draw for the group stage of the 2023/2024 Champions League will be conducted today, Thursday, August 31 at the Grimaldi Forum in Monaco from 5pm West African Time (WAT).

Real Madrid, Barcelona, Bayern Munich, Manchester United, Arsenal, Manchester City, Paris Saint-Germain, and AC Milan are just some of the major clubs that will be competing in the Champions League flagship tournament.

A total of 32 teams compete in the Champions League group stage and they will be divided into four pots of eight for the draw.

Which clubs have qualified for the 2023/2024 Champions League?

England:

Arsenal, Manchester City, Manchester United, Newcastle United

Spain:

Atletico Madrid, Barcelona, Real Madrid, Real Sociedad, Sevilla

Germany:

Bayern Munich, Borussia Dortmund, Leipzig, Union Berlin

Italy:

Inter Milan, Lazio, AC Milan, Napoli

France:

Lens, Paris Saint-Germain

Portugal:

Benfica, Porto, Braga

Netherlands:

Feyenoord, PSV

Austria:

Salzburg

Scotland:

Celtic

Serbia:

Red Star Belgrade

Ukraine:

Shakhtar Donetsk

Belgium:

Antwerp

Switzerland:

Young Boys

Turkey:

Galatasaray
